Brief Summary

This phase I trial is studying the side effects and best dose of sorafenib in treating patients with metastatic or unresectable solid tumors, multiple myeloma, or non-Hodgkin's lymphoma with or without impaired liver or kidney function. Sorafenib may stop the growth of cancer cells by blocking some of the enzymes needed for cell growth and by blocking blood flow to the cancer. Sorafenib may have different effects in patients who have changes in their liver or kidney function

Outcome Measures

Primary Outcomes (6)

  • Relationship between the pharmacokinetics and measures of renal dysfunction categorized by creatinine clearance as estimated by the Cockcroft and Gault formula (Part 1)

    Explored using standard parametric and non-parametric methods for one- and two-way analysis of variance (ANOVA) layouts (the dysfunction factor (hepatic/renal) and the severity factor (mild, moderate, severe, very severe).

    Prior to and at 1, 2, 3, 4, 6, and 24 hours post-dose on day 1

  • Severity of hepatic disease as assessed by the Child-Pugh criteria

    Non-parametric measures of association for ordinal data will be employed.

    Up to 3 months

  • Distribution of and association patterns between the Child-Pugh score and that of patient's risk of toxicity beyond each dose or cohort, assessed using the National Cancer Institute Common Terminology Criteria for Adverse Events (NCI CTCAE) v3.0

    Up to 5 years

  • Mean levels of area under the curve (AUC) using the ANOVA model

    90% confidence intervals for the relative change (from mild to moderate and from moderate to severe) of the mean AUC levels will be calculated.

    Up to 12 weeks

  • Maximum tolerated dose (MTD) of sorafenib tosylate, assessed using the NCI CTCAE v3.0 (Part 2)

    Up to 4 weeks

  • Dose-limiting toxicities (DLT), defined as any grade 3 or greater non-hematologic toxicity, assessed using the NCI CTCAE v3.0

    Up to 7 weeks

Study Arms (1)

Treatment (sorafenib tosylate)

EXPERIMENTAL

Patients receive oral sorafenib once on day 1 and then once daily, twice daily, or every other day beginning on day 8 and continuing for 3 months. Patients are re-evaluated at 3 months. Patients with responding disease may continue study treatment in the absence of disease progression or unacceptable toxicity. Cohorts of 3-6 patients (per treatment cohort) receive escalating doses of sorafenib until the MTD is determined. The MTD is defined as the dose preceding that at which 2 of 3 or 2 of 6 patients experience dose-limiting toxicity. At least 6 patients are treated at the MTD.
